Essential Functions

  • Assists in the oral health management of all clinic patients.
  • Obtains baseline oral hygiene assessment data based upon accepted principles of oral hygiene and periodontal care.
  • Documents and maintains accurate dental records that reflects the nature of the contract in which the patient presents at the time of treatment.
  • Provides oral health education and appropriate individual counseling for all center dental patients.
  • Provides clinical oral hygiene services including dental prophylaxis, scaling, sealant application and fluoride application consistent with accepted professional practices and standards and in compliance with applicable state law and the center’s clinical protocols.
  • Integrates appropriate patient dental hygiene care with other healthcare professionals involved in the patient’s health care management.
  • Affords technical assistance and health education in the community as requested.
  • Performs independent procedures as delegated and directed by a dentist in accordance with state regulations and law as well as Dental Department protocol and directive.
  • Maintains all Dental Department areas in compliance with Dental Department directive and policies as well as center policies and procedures relative to infection control, exposure control and safety issues.
  • Ensures the proper disposal of all contaminated or potentially contaminated materials in accordance with Dental Department directive and center policy as well as state federal regulations(s).
  • Complies in full with the center’s Exposure Control Plan.
  • Travels when necessary to meet operational needs.
  • As directed by a supervisor, performs other related and/or necessary tasks to achieve organizational and programmatic goals and objectives.
  • Responsible for personal compliance with all applicable federal, state, local and center rules, regulations, protocols and procedures governing the practice of dental hygiene and the clinical provision of dental hygiene services as well as those relating to, but not limited to, personnel issues, work place safety, public health and confidentiality.

Minimum Qualifications

  • Graduation from an accredited school of dental hygiene.
  • Ability to establish and maintain effective professional relationships with fellow healthcare providers.
  • Excellent interpersonal and written communications skills required.
  • Ability to maintain appropriate clinical privileges required.
  • FTCA coverage or private professional malpractice insurance obtainable.
  • Unrestricted license to practice Oral Hygiene in the State of Montana.
  • Current CPR (BLS) certification.
